Antioxidant Properties and Free Radical Scavenging
One of the primary mechanisms through which asiatic acid powder exerts its anti-aging effects is its potent antioxidant activity. Free radicals, unstable molecules that can damage cellular structures, are a major contributor to the aging process. Asiatic acid has demonstrated remarkable free radical scavenging abilities, helping to neutralize these harmful molecules and protect cells from oxidative stress.
Studies have shown that asiatic acid can enhance the body's natural antioxidant defenses by stimulating the production of enzymes such as superoxide dismutase and catalase. These enzymes play crucial roles in neutralizing free radicals and preventing oxidative damage to cellular components, including DNA, proteins, and lipids. By bolstering the body's antioxidant capacity, asiatic acid powder may help slow down the aging process at a cellular level.
Collagen Synthesis and Skin Elasticity
Another exciting aspect of asiatic acid's anti-aging potential lies in its ability to promote collagen synthesis. Collagen, a vital protein that provides structure and elasticity to the skin, tends to decrease with age, leading to wrinkles and sagging skin. Research has shown that asiatic acid can stimulate fibroblasts, the cells responsible for producing collagen, thereby potentially improving skin elasticity and reducing the appearance of fine lines and wrinkles.
Moreover, asiatic acid has been found to inhibit enzymes that break down collagen, such as matrix metalloproteinases (MMPs). By preserving existing collagen and promoting the production of new collagen fibers, asiatic acid powder may help maintain skin firmness and youthfulness. This dual action on collagen metabolism makes it a promising ingredient in anti-aging skincare formulations.

Safety and Side Effects of Asiatic Acid Powder
As with any potential therapeutic compound, understanding the safety profile and possible side effects of Asiatic Acid Powder is paramount. While this naturally-derived substance shows promise in anti-aging research, it's crucial to approach its use with a balanced perspective, considering both its benefits and potential risks.
Evaluating the Safety Profile
Asiatic Acid Powder, derived from the Centella asiatica plant, has been used in traditional medicine for centuries. This long history of use provides some reassurance regarding its safety. However, modern scientific scrutiny is necessary to fully understand its effects on the human body, particularly when used in concentrated forms.
Recent studies have shown that Asiatic Acid exhibits low toxicity in various experimental models. In vitro and animal studies suggest that it has a favorable safety profile when used within recommended dosages. However, it's important to note that most of these studies have been conducted in laboratory settings, and more extensive human trials are needed to conclusively establish its safety for long-term use.
Researchers are particularly interested in understanding how Asiatic Acid interacts with different biological systems. Its ability to modulate cellular processes, while beneficial for anti-aging effects, necessitates careful examination to ensure it doesn't disrupt normal physiological functions.
Potential Side Effects and Precautions
While Asiatic Acid Powder is generally well-tolerated, some individuals may experience mild side effects. These can include:
1. Gastrointestinal discomfort: Some users report mild nausea or stomach upset when first starting to use Asiatic Acid supplements.
2. Skin reactions: In rare cases, topical application of products containing Asiatic Acid may cause skin irritation or allergic reactions in sensitive individuals.
3. Headaches: A small percentage of users have reported experiencing headaches, particularly when starting with higher doses.
It's worth noting that these side effects are typically mild and often subside as the body adjusts to the compound. However, individuals with pre-existing medical conditions or those taking other medications should exercise caution and consult with a healthcare professional before incorporating Asiatic Acid Powder into their regimen.
Pregnant and breastfeeding women should also avoid using Asiatic Acid supplements due to the lack of comprehensive safety data in these populations. Similarly, individuals with liver or kidney disorders should seek medical advice before use, as the metabolism and excretion of Asiatic Acid may be affected by these conditions.
Dosage Considerations and Drug Interactions
Determining the optimal dosage of Asiatic Acid Powder is an area of ongoing research. Current studies suggest that moderate doses are well-tolerated, but the exact therapeutic range may vary depending on the intended use and individual factors. It's crucial to follow manufacturer recommendations or consult with a healthcare provider to establish an appropriate dosage.
Potential drug interactions are another important consideration. Asiatic Acid has been shown to influence certain enzymes involved in drug metabolism. This could potentially affect the efficacy or safety of other medications. For instance, preliminary research suggests that Asiatic Acid may interact with drugs metabolized by the cytochrome P450 enzyme system, which is responsible for processing many commonly prescribed medications.
As research in this area evolves, it's becoming increasingly clear that personalized approaches to using Asiatic Acid Powder may be necessary. Factors such as age, overall health status, and concurrent medications all play a role in determining the most appropriate and safe use of this compound.
